Well, since the local dirt oval closed down, I've turned my attention back to building. After looking at my tractor sitting in the corner for the last several months, I decided something wasn't right about it. After disassembly, I cut 2" from the length, and added 1" to the height. The scale is much more in proportion, but it made a challenge trying to get the radio gear and battery to fit. I ended up making a removable tray, and mounting the battery over the top of everything else.... Of course I had to add a few more details...like clutch/brake pedals, access covers, and better gauges.
